CAM bottom paste layer issue...

autodeskguest
autodeskguest over 17 years ago

Hi, I though that I understood this but apparently not and I would

appreciate some help:

 

I have never had SMT parts placed on the bottom layer until now so the fact

that Eagle has layer 32 (bottom paste) disabled never bothered me before.

Now I need it. I have edited the Eagle.scr file so that layer 32 is used but

I still can't get the layer to appear when I restart Eagle. It DOES appear

if I run the Eagle script once Eagle has started my board. But while the

layer then shows up in PCB it does not show up in the CAM processor so I

can't output a stencil Gerber. What am I missing?

    Ira Faberman schrieb:

    Hi, I though that I understood this but apparently not and I would

    appreciate some help:

     

    I have never had SMT parts placed on the bottom layer until now so the fact

    that Eagle has layer 32 (bottom paste) disabled never bothered me before.

    Now I need it. I have edited the Eagle.scr file so that layer 32 is used but

    I still can't get the layer to appear when I restart Eagle. It DOES appear

    if I run the Eagle script once Eagle has started my board. But while the

    layer then shows up in PCB it does not show up in the CAM processor so I

    can't output a stencil Gerber. What am I missing?

     

    Thanks...

     

    If I understand correctly, layer 32 appears in the DISPLAY layer list,

    but not in the CAM Processors layer list.

    Did you save the board file after runnning the eagle.scr file to

    activate layer 32? I suppose you changed SET USED_LAYER there.

    The used_layers are stored in the brd file, the CAM Processor loads

    the file and does not know about displaying layer 32.

    Thanks Richard. Saving the file made the difference. I had thought that the

    eagle.scr ran each time the board was opened, so I could not explain why the

    board seemed to revert and not show the layer. Disclaimer: I should know

    better than to try to make sense of anything while I have the flu!
